What is a 20 Feet Container?
A 20 feet container, describing its length, is a basic intermodal container used for carrying items and items. It is generally constructed from steel, using toughness and strength to endure extreme ecological conditions during transit. 2. Requirements of a 20 Feet Container
Comprehending the specifications of a 20 feet container is important for identifying its viability for different shipping needs. Below is an in-depth table laying out the dimensions and weight capabilities of a standard 20 feet container.
RequirementsStandard ContainerExternal Length20 feet (6.058 meters)External Width8 feet (2.438 meters)External Height8.5 feet (2.591 meters)Internal Length19.4 feet (5.898 meters)Internal Width7.7 feet (2.352 meters)Internal Height7.9 feet (2.392 meters)Max Payload CapacityApprox. 28,200 lbs (12,700 kg)Tare WeightApprox. 4,850 pounds (2,200 kg)
These dimensions can a little differ depending upon the producer and particular design functions, especially in specialized containers.
3. Types of 20 Feet Containers
20 feet containers can be found in different types to accommodate different shipping requirements. They include:
Standard Dry Container: The most common type, suitable for basic cargo.Reefer Container: A cooled container developed for disposable products.Open Top Container: Suitable for oversized freight that can not fit through standard doors.Flat Rack Container: Used for heavy or large cargo, using an open structure.High Cube Container: Offers extra height compared to a standard container for additional capacity.4.
